Medical Assisting - 50260

1300 hours

(Selective Admission)

Indian River State College awards a Certificate to each student who satisfactorily completes the required course of study. The purpose of the program is to prepare medical assistants who are competent in the cognitive (knowledge), psychomotor (skills), and affective (behavior) learning domains to enter the profession. Classroom theory and clinical practice prepare the student to perform a wide range of tasks ranging from examinations room techniques, to assisting with minor surgery, administering medications, educating patients, performing diagnostic procedures including drawing blood and electrocardiography, scheduling appointments, maintaining patient files, and completing insurance forms. The program is accredited by the Commission on Accreditation of Allied Health Education Programs (CAAHEP) upon the recommendation of the Medical Assisting Review Board (MAERB) - 9355 113th St. N, #7709, Seminole, Fl 33775, (727) 210-2350. Upon successful completion of the Certification exam, the graduate will be awarded the credential CMA (AAMA), Certified Medical Assistant from the American Association of Medical Assistants.
